Agreement States must maintain
material regulatory programs compatible with NRC's and provide
biennial information on their programs. NRC uses the information to
ensure State radiation control programs are compatible with NRC's,
meet the requirements of the Atomic Energy Act, and are adequate to
protect the public health and safety.
